One of the most emotive and grossly underrated Eurythmics tracks ever in my humble opinion. The song was inspired by an Aunt of Annie Lennox in Aberdeen who sadly took her own life in 1987.
Sadly, the video was never shown on MTV in America at the time because it was perceived as dealing with issues around the occult, and could cause "outrage in certain sections of American society". So much for 'the land of the free'!!!
Annie is a wonderful person, still has a home in Aberdeen where she was born, and has (personally) raised over £60 million over the years for various medical research and welfare charities around the world for people and animals in need. Good on ya Annie!
